David S. Wichmann Named President, UnitedHealth Group Operations
Minneapolis (April 22, 2008) – UnitedHealth Group (NYSE: UNH) today
announced that David S. Wichmann has assumed the position of executive vice
president of UnitedHealth Group and president of UnitedHealth Group Operations.
He will be charged with optimizing business performance across UnitedHealth
Group and within each of the market groups and business segments. Mr. Wichmann
will report to Stephen J. Hemsley, president and chief executive officer of
UnitedHealth Group, and the Board of Directors. In a separate press release
today, the Company announced that Gail K. Boudreaux will join as executive vice
president of UnitedHealth Group and president of the Commercial Markets Group,
effective May 5, 2008, the position previously held by Mr. Wichmann.

In Mr. Wichmann’s newly expanded role, he will be dedicated to driving the
necessary change across UnitedHealth Group for improved performance at every
level of the business. Mr. Wichmann’s direct accountabilities and priorities
will include: -
Optimizing business performance across the UnitedHealth Group enterprise and
within each of its market groups and business segments;
-
Strengthening UnitedHealth Group’s organizational structure and helping to
attract and place strong talent where necessary to respond to the rising
complexities of the businesses and to improve the speed of decision-making and
innovation;
-
Addressing areas of business unit and process alignment across the business
groups, segments and units of the enterprise, along with achieving consistent
geographic alignment across all Health Care Services businesses so that
UnitedHealth Group faces local and regional markets and engages all stakeholders
in an orderly, seamless fashion;
-
Overseeing the Company’s operations, technology, integration and quality agenda
in each business and on an enterprise basis; and
-
Managing corporate development, capital investment and deployment, international
operations, strategic market expansions, and all integration activities across
the enterprise.
About UnitedHealth Group
UnitedHealth Group is a diversified health and well-being company dedicated to
making health care work better. Headquartered in Minneapolis, Minn.,
UnitedHealth Group offers a broad spectrum of products and services through
seven operating businesses: UnitedHealthcare, Ovations, AmeriChoice, Uniprise,
OptumHealth, Ingenix, and Prescription Solutions. Through its family of
businesses, UnitedHealth Group serves approximately 70 million individuals
nationwide.
